FormFree announces integration with Ellie Mae

Integration allows Encompass® users to verify an applicant’s bank records in just minutes through FormFree’s AccountChek™

ATLANTA, GA (September 17, 2014) — FormFree Holdings Corporation, a leading provider of automated asset verifications, announced that its award-winning, patented solution, AccountChek™, is now available through Ellie Mae’s Encompass® mortgage management solution.

The integration between the two solutions enables Encompass users to order, analyze and certify a borrower’s electronic bank statement data. The result is the industry’s first digital “Asset Report” that enables lenders to quickly verify borrower’s assets and perform a number of rich analytics, which significantly reduce the time required to originate loans. In addition, the AccountChek solution virtually eliminates one of the major issues in lending – bank statement fraud.

AccountChek Verification of Deposits & Assets can be found in Encompass under the Order Verification services tab.

Winner of the 2013 Mortgage Technology Fix-It Award, AccountChek, FormFree’s flagship, patent-protected asset verification solution, helps lenders of all sizes eliminate fraud while removing the need for borrowers to supply paper bank statements to get a loan. AccountChek collects data directly from virtually any financial institution and generates reports in just minutes, creating enormous time savings for both the borrower and the lender. By eliminating the need for paper bank statements, AccountChek also helps significantly reduce buyback exposure and fraud, while also providing lenders with an easy solution for complying with new “ability-to-pay” rules.

About FormFree
FormFree Holdings Corporation is a privately-held technology provider that specializes in helping financial institutions determine the ability of their customers to pay back loans and reduce closing times by automating the financial verification process. FormFree has partnered with Equifax and other industry-leading credit and financial service providers to collect, certify and analyze data and help customers make better lending decisions. Its flagship product, AccountChek, is an automated, paperless verification of deposits and assets solution that has received an Innovation Award from the PROGRESS in Lending Association, Mortgage Technology magazine’s “Fix-It” Award, and was the category winner in HousingWire magazine’s 2014 HW TECH100 list of the most innovative technology companies in the housing industry. FormFree was founded in 2008 and is based in Atlanta, Georgia. For more information, visit www.FormFree.com.
